The hydrogen ion concentration of a solution is 1.6 x 10-4?mol dm-3. Find the pH of this solution.
The pH of the solution is:
pH = -log?? [H?]
pH = -log?? 1.6 x 10-4?= 3.796
pH = 3.8
The hydrogen ion concentration of a solution of sodium hydroxide is 3.5 x 10-11?mol dm-3. Find the pH of this solution.
The pH of the solution is:
pH = -log?? [H?]
pH = -log?? 3.5 x 10-11?= 10.456
pH = 10.5
Ethanoic acid (also known as acetic acid) is a weak acid produced by wood ants that they can spray at predators as a defence mechanism. The hydrogen ion concentration of a sample of ethanoic acid taken from some wood ants was 8.39 x 10-6?mol dm-3. Find the pH of the ethanoic acid produced by wood ants.
The pH of the solution is:
pH = -log?? [H?]
pH = -log?? 8.39 x 10-6?= 5.076
pH = 5.08
Don’t forget the minus sign in the formula:?pH = -log?? [H?].?This is easy to overlook and is a common mistake that students make in exams. Remember: pH must fall between 0 and 14 so if your answer is outside of this range, something has gone wrong! Also, as seen in worked examples above, the question may give you a clue as to what your answer should roughly be. For example, we know that sodium hydroxide is an alkali, so a pH of 10.5 makes sense and we are told that the ethanoic acid produced by wood ants is a weak acid, so 5.08 makes sense too!
